Tambi is a village located in Jaoli Taluka of Satara district in Maharashtra. Around 9 families reside in Tambi village. Tambi village is administered by Sarpanch(Head of village) who is elected every five years.
As per the Census India 2011, Tambi village has population of 29 of which 12 are males and 17 are females. The population of children between age 0-6 is 3 which is 10.34% of total population.
The sex-ratio of Tambi village is around
1417 compared to
929 which is average of Maharashtra state. The literacy rate of Tambi village is 37.93% out of which 33.33% males are literate and 41.18% females are literate. There are 0 Scheduled Caste (SC) and 0 Scheduled Tribe (ST) of total population in Tambi village.
